java.lang.Object
com.presumo.jms.persistence.PersistentQueueTest.TestOperation
com.presumo.jms.persistence.PersistentQueueTest.ReversibleTestOperation
- Direct Known Subclasses:
- PersistentQueueTest._DELETE, PersistentQueueTest._GET_NEXT, PersistentQueueTest._PUSH
- Enclosing class:
- PersistentQueueTest
- private abstract static class PersistentQueueTest.ReversibleTestOperation
- extends PersistentQueueTest.TestOperation
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
PersistentQueueTest.ReversibleTestOperation
private PersistentQueueTest.ReversibleTestOperation()
undo
public abstract void undo(PersistentQueueTest.TestState state)
throws java.lang.Exception
removeNonPersistent
protected void removeNonPersistent(PersistentQueueTest.TestState st)
getFile
protected java.io.File getFile(PersistentQueueTest.TestState state,
int file_type)
copyFile
protected void copyFile(java.io.File src,
java.io.File dst)
throws java.lang.Exception
copyFile
protected void copyFile(java.io.File src,
java.io.File dst,
int size)
throws java.lang.Exception
basicSanityCheck
protected void basicSanityCheck(PersistentQueueTest.TestState state)
throws java.lang.Exception
createRandomString
protected java.lang.String createRandomString()
createRandomString
protected java.lang.String createRandomString(int maxsize)
createMessage
protected com.presumo.jms.message.JmsMessage createMessage(int id,
boolean persistent)
throws java.lang.Exception
operate
public abstract void operate(PersistentQueueTest.TestState state)
throws java.lang.Exception